Hello!

We are a new family to DVC through a resale purchase a few months ago. I put in a waitlist for VGC February 2-6 for a studio. I know my chances of getting the waitlist confirmed is slim so I did book back up reservations off property. This being our 1st trip to disneyland as DVC members I was wondering if anyone has had any luck getting anything last minute during this time. It is supposed to be a slow period.

Also is there anyway to find out what number you are on the waitlist?

There's no way to find out what "number" you are because the waitlist is variable, some people have 1 night, some have 10. So when dates come open, they look to the list for the first person who requested those dates. If you have 4 nights on waitlist and 3 come open, they skip over you.

You could stalk the website to see if any of the nights open and grab them. If they all don't come through or if you don't want a split stay, cancel 31 days or more before and keep your backup.

Check the website every day.... thats what I had to do for some of our nights at Aulani.... whenever a night would come open I would grab it asap!

You should know that the studio category is the most difficult to get at VGC because there are not very many of them.... it helps if you can be flexible with your room category. VGC is the smallest of all the DVC resorts and thus that 7 month (and 11 month if it is your home resort) booking window is super important there.

I should also add that "slow" times for Disney are not necessarily slow times for DVC.... because of the lower points requirements for booking it can be the time when many DVC members will book.

Thanks for all the advice! I have been stalking everyday. Is there a better time to check? Morning or night or both? I'm on Hawaii time so I'm 6 hours behind est.
 
It's hard to say which is better... I have heard that the DVC waitlists are filled during the night (EST), so it may be better to check before DVC goes to fill a waitlist. So checking 2x's a day cant hurt. It just is really based on if someone cancels and when...

GCV is one of the toughest, but I wouldnt give up trying. You may be able to at least get a couple of days, and that will be really helpful to get the DLR onsite early entry perks for at least part of your stay.
 


Hi just a quick update!

Thanks to all your wonderful tips, so far I managed to book a 1 bedroom for the 1st 2 nights of our stay! The 2 nights popped up at separate times on the website and I grabbed both. Then called member services about linking the 2 reservations to one so we won't have to change rooms and they were able to. I'm still waitlisted for the studio and now have another waitlist for the 1 bedroom for the last 2 nights.
